Suggest Remedy For Constant Head Tremor Due To Dystonia

I have distonia and have had this head tremor since I was 30. My sister had this same problem and tried to solve it by getting medication from the Dr. she was going to, but she seemed to need more and got another dr. prescribing meds , she ended up in a nursing home when she was in her early sixies. and died when she was 80.. I didnt want to take this route so after going to a neurologist in Ottawa, tried the meds the Dr. prescribed but found I couldnt breath 13 or so days after taking the meds so a few years later I tried again and after 10 days or so I fainted from taking them. Since then I have been struggling with the effects of this decease and only taking a lorazem pill 0.5 mg. when going to the dentist or a funeral , now I know I have to get something that will agree with me , and I need to see a Dr. like Dr. Da Silva , that I have heard is very compassionate and I can t wait 6 months for an appointment. Do you think you could help me, by the way,, I m now 84, but other than this I m energetic and walk and swim a lot and eat a healthy diet. I was going to Dr. Grimes but his meds or botox never worked for me so I want to go to another neurologist. Sincerely and desperate, Kathleen C. MacDonald

Neurologist 's  Response
Hello Kathleen!

Welcome on Healthcaremagic!

I read carefully your question and understand your concern!

I would recommend trying clonazepam with a low dose and increase slowly for your head tremor. This drug is better compared to lorazepam, which is not recommended as long term therapy, because it can cause addiction and tolerance.
Starting at a low dose (0.25mg at night) and increasing slowly (0.25mg every 3 days), until reaching the dose of 2mg daily, will help improve your situation, without experiencing its adverse effects.

You should discuss with your doctor on the above issues.
